Hazel Cottage - King, Double & Twin Bedrooms

Hazel Cottage offers all the luxury you require while on holiday. The largest of all our cottages, with three bedrooms, Hazel is a lovely, quiet home from home for up to six guests. The open plan sitting room has a picture window overlooking our central courtyard and a Charnwood wood burning stove in centre of the living space. Hazel has really flexible sleeping arrangements. On the ground floor, there is a large bedroom that can be set as either a super-king or twin – it has its own en-suite bathroom too. Upstairs, there are two other bedrooms, one a spacious double, the other a twin, both of which share an additional toilet and large walk in luxury shower room.  If it’s a little chilly and you fancy a night in, you can light the eco friendly wood burning stove in the lounge, chill on the leather bean bag and surf the internet on free-to-access WiFi broadband or watch satellite TV and DVDs.
 
   

If you want to relax outdoors with a glass of wine or something stronger, you can use your patio, looking out over the Lochan up to Crubenbeag Mountain on a warm summers evening or, alternatively, surveying the same beautiful view on a crisp clear winter’s morning, snug and warm inside the full width windows of Hazel's Lounge. All our guests have access to free fishing in our Lochan which is stocked with brown trout. There is also a golf practice area, a games room which has just been refurbished. There is a pool table in the games room and various other games to keep the kids busy!
